About The Breath was hired on to work with Historica Canada to make two Heritage Minutes. Director Shane Belcourt and Producer Michelle St. John worked closely with screenwriter Joseph Campbell to bring these challenging issues into one-minute education spots. About This 2016 CSA-Nominated and 2015 CSC Award-Winning one-hour performance arts documentary, is a stunning journey into Iroquoian teachings on love, life, community, and spirit, as expressed through dance (both traditional and modern).
